Marie Marguerite Granger was born about December 1781 in St. Landry Parish, Louisiana, New Spain. Her parents were Jean Baptiste Granger and Susanne Cormier.[1]

Marguerite Granger married Celestin Landry of Lafourche, son of Joseph Rene Landry and Marie Rose Melanson, on 8 May 1810 in St. Martin Parish, Louisiana.[2]

Their known children were:

  1. Caroline Landry (1811– )
  2. Marguerite Cidalise Landry (1812– )
  3. Francoise Landry (1814–1816)
  4. Euphrasie Landry, twin (1817–1818)
  5. Unnamed Infant Landry, twin (1817–1817)
  6. Marie Carmesile (Carmelite) Landry (1818–1916)
  7. Eugenie Landry (1823– )

She was widowed in 1837.[3]

Sources

  1. Donald J. Hébert, Southwest Louisiana Records, 1750-1900, compact disk #101 ("SWLR CD") (Rayne, Louisiana: Hébert Publications, 2001; reprints by Claitor's Publications);
    GRANGER, Marie Marguerite (Jean Baptiste & Susanne CORMIE) bt. 10 Feb. 1782 at age 2 mths. Spons: Jean COMOT & Marie Louise CORMIER. Fr. L.M. GRUMEAU (Opel. Ch.: v.1-A, p.26)
  2. Hébert, SWLR CD;
    GRANGER, Marguerite - of Opelousas (major daughter of Jean Baptiste - of Cote Gelee & Susanne CORMIER) m. 8 May 1810 Celestin LANDRY - of Lafourche (minor son of Joseph - of Cote Gelee & Marie MELANCON) Wits: Celestin PREJEAN, Benjamin MIRE, Joseph DUGAS. Fr. Gabriel ISABEY (SM Ch.: v.5, #175)
  3. Hébert, SWLR CD;
    LANDRY, Celestin m. Marguerite GRANGER d. 29 Dec. 1837 at age 48 yrs. (Laf. Ch.: v. 3, p. 122)
